St Helena Inverted "c" Slug

I have indentified 5 different Postmarks from the GVI Definitives, which are illustrated in my "The St Helena George VI Definitives" published this year.

  • The different types are:
  • Type 1 and 3 with T in St Helena underlined using 'A' and 'C' slugs.
  • Type 2 with T in St Helena not underlined using 'C' slug
  • Type 4 "Briers" CDS
  • Type 5 June 1946 CDS with constricted 6 in 1946.
 

There are also the Madame Joseph Forged CDS.

At the York 2000 Stamp Fair I came across the item below which shows the 'C' slug reversed. This is part of a Type 2 CDS therefore it must have occured sometime after 1948.
